Biography

Wrestler Josef Böck was a civil servant at the German Reichsbahn. He won two German youth titles before winning the German freestyle featherweight title in the Olympic year, 1936. He then qualified for the Berlin Games where he was eliminated in the second round after two losses. After the Games he obtained two more podiums as runner-up in the German Championships. Böck later became a referee and sports official.
